We are looking for an experienced Financial Controller to join STRAT7 on a 12-month fixed-term contract, providing maternity cover. The Financial Controller role is the backbone of STRAT7 Limited's financial operations genuinely making an impact on how STRAT7 Limited performs and scales. The role reports to the Group Financial Controller owning comprehensive financial statements, balance sheet reconciliations, and management accounts. The position keeps all regulatory requirements tight, maintains the central P&L, reconciles inter-agency transactions, and manages tax submissions and fixed asset records. Working closely with Finance Business Partners across agency divisions, this role supports budgeting and forecasting while laying the financial groundwork for the organisation's operational and commercial goals.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
- Produce accurate and timely trial balance and management accounts for STRAT7 Ltd
- Prepare and reconcile balance sheets, liaising with Agency Finance Business Partners as required
- Maintain ownership of STRAT7 central P&L and ensure alignment with sum of agency P&Ls
- Prepare ONS submissions for STRAT7 Ltd
- Process PSA calculations and other ongoing tax requirements
- Process payroll postings and review pension payments
- Maintain intra-agency reconciliation and sign-off
- Reconcile inter-agency balances involving STRAT7 Limited at each month end
- Process internal cost re-allocation postings and reconciliations
- Maintain Fixed Asset register and process depreciation postings
- Maintain Intangible Asset register and process capitalisation calculations
- Process Agency Job books review and Net Revenue submission
- Gather client and supplier rebates information from Agency Finance Business Partners
- Support FP&A team in the production of Budget / Forecast process
- Support FP&A team in the production of pipeline reporting
- Prepare ad hoc queries and analysis relating to STRAT7 Ltd
- Manage the transactional team members
SKILLS & ATTRIBUTES
- A professional accounting qualification (ACA, ACCA, CIMA or equivalent)
- Proficient in Microsoft Office and accounting/reporting software systems
- Strong technical accounting skills and knowledge of UK GAAP and audit practices
- Meticulous attention to detail with excellent analytical and problem‑solving capabilities
- Ability to manage multiple priorities, work under pressure and meet tight deadlines
- Effective communicator who can liaise clearly across all levels
- Advanced Excel skills to include aggregation / lookup formulae and Power Queries
- Experience of use of artificial intelligence in a finance function
- Use of financial reporting / visualisation tools such as Datarails
